Lidocaine 4% and tetracaine 1% exhibit significant mydriatic effects upon topical administration in eyes with pale irides. The mydriatic effect is more rapid and prolonged with lidocaine than with tetracaine. WebThe most commonly used mydriatics in adults are tropicamide and phenylephrine as their dilatory effects wear off sooner. In children, cyclopentolate is more commonly used.
